Dental Services, Eyeglasses And Hearing Aids
Next » « Previous12/15
Oral care post-diagnosis is important to avoid unnecessary infections. On the other hand, oral problems can be caused by a health condition, treatments and/or drugs. You may also need eyeglasses and/or hearing aids.
If you have health coverage, check to see what is covered.
You may be able to purchase dental insurance despite your health condition.
For uninsured products and services, there is help available.
